The cause of an overnight fire that damaged four garage bays at Cape Cod Collision in Barnstable is under investigation. At 12:35 a.m. Sunday, crews from the Barnstable Fire Department were dispatched to 146 Thornton Drive for a call of a structure fire in a large commercial building. "The fire was brought under control through an aggressive interior attack to ensure the fire did not spread to an adjoining building and adjacent structures," Fire Chief Christopher A. Beal said in a press release.

Whether it’s for heating assistance, rent, or extra money for food expenses, Cape Cod and Islands residents could use a little extra help this time of the year. The Cape Cod Times is once again launching the Cape Cod Times Neighbors Fund holiday fundraising campaign to give community members the help they need. Founded in 1936, the fund (formerly known as the Needy Fund) has assisted thousands of people.

Fire crews respond to massive fire at former Anthony’s Cummaquid Inn in Yarmouth Port Linda MurphyYARMOUTH PORT— Fire crews are on the scene of a massive fire at the former Anthony's Cummaquid Inn on Route 6A. According to published reports, the call for the fire came in Sunday evening about 6:30. Flames and smoke could be seen for miles around. Fire crews from Yarmouth, Brewster, Harwich, Barnstable are on scene along with the Provincetown canteen.
